Curve 57420k1

57420 = 22 · 32 · 5 · 11 · 29



Data for elliptic curve 57420k1

Field Data Notes
Atkin-Lehner 2- 3- 5+ 11- 29- Signs for the Atkin-Lehner involutions
Class 57420k Isogeny class
Conductor 57420 Conductor
∏ cp 24 Product of Tamagawa factors cp
deg 79872 Modular degree for the optimal curve
Δ 53412313680 = 24 · 38 · 5 · 112 · 292 Discriminant
Eigenvalues 2- 3- 5+  2 11-  2  0  4 Hecke eigenvalues for primes up to 20
Equation [0,0,0,-16248,-797087] [a1,a2,a3,a4,a6]
Generators [152:495:1] Generators of the group modulo torsion
j 40670164811776/4579245 j-invariant
L 6.7465766397589 L(r)(E,1)/r!
Ω 0.42286575033304 Real period
R 2.6590695488831 Regulator
r 1 Rank of the group of rational points
S 0.99999999998545 (Analytic) order of Ш
t 2 Number of elements in the torsion subgroup
Twists 19140i1 Quadratic twists by: -3
